Summer Food Distribution
Roadrunner Food Bank will continue to offer support in some schools. Families should contact their school for more information.
Non- APS RRFB locations
- Tuesdays, 8:00 am, EXPO NM – 300 San Pedro Dr. NE until further notice. Please enter using Gate 3 off San Pedro and Copper. Gates open at 7 am.
- Thursdays, 10:30 am, Highland High School – 4700 Coal Ave (caddy-corner lot near previous distribution parking lot) has been extended through the end of May. Use entry off Jefferson near the high school (south of Silver).
City Lunch Program will take place in 36 sites throughout the city in parks and community centers starting June 1st, more information call 311.
The Store House offers once a month support. Families can go to the Storehouse once per calendar month. Please take a photo ID. The pantry is open to the public from 9 am to noon Wednesday, Friday and Saturday. The pantry is located at 106 Broadway Blvd SE in downtown Albuquerque, just south of Central.
Presbyterian Hospital will be offering FREE HEALTHY meals to kids. Please refer to attached flyer or call 505-291-2621 for more information.

New Mexico Dream Team
My name is Michelle Soto and I work with the New Mexico Dream Team on the city's Financial Navigators Program. Our work focuses on helping Burqueños deal with the financial impact of COVID-19 by remotely triaging critical financial priorities with clients and connecting them to social services and other resources by referral. Services and referrals that help with
- Rent & mortgage payment assistance
- Eviction prevention
- Utility payment assistance
- Food & food stamps (SNAP)
- Unemployment insurance payments
- Medicaid or ACA health insurance (beWellNM)
- Childcare & childcare assistance payments
- Organizations that can help you with the applications
